Board of Trustees
Timothy M Rutter FRCS (Chairman)
Before becoming our Chairman, Mr Rutter practised as an obstetrician and gynaecologist at the highest level for over 25 years. He brings expertise in programme design and management, and has worked as our Senior Gynaecological Consultant responsible for project development of clinic based programmes in developing countries.
Mr Rutter has in-depth knowledge of the international context, having occupied senior medical positions with the Government of Thailand, the Canadian Government and Christian Aid. He was appointed Executive Director at the Transnational Birth Control Programme in 1973.
In addition to his professional work, Mr Rutter has undertaken post-graduate specialisations in Gynaecology & Obstetrics at St George’s Hospital Medical School and as Gynaecology & Obstetrics Senior House Officer at Queen Charlotte’s & Chelsea Hospital. He has also held lectureships at four leading research institutions, notably Universidad de Cadiz and Universidad Autonamia de Barcelona.
Getachew Bekele
Getachew has worked for Marie Stopes International for over 19 years. He plays a key role in national and global advocacy on issues related to family planning and sexual and reproductive health and was the founding member and chairman of the Consortium of Reproductive health Associations in Ethiopia (CORHA). He also serves on the board of the AIDS Prevention and Support Organisation (ISAPSO) and the Mothers and Children Multisectoral Development Organisation (MSMDO).
Dr Tim Black CBE MBBS MRCP DTM&H MPH
Dr Black has specialised in international family planning for 35 years. Dr Black served as chief executive of Marie Stopes International, based in London, for 35 years, stepping down in 2006. He is now a consultant and advisor worldwide to reproductive health and social marketing programmes.
The Baroness Flather JP DL FRSA of Windsor and Maidenhead
Baroness Flather was elevated to the House of Lords in 1990. During her time in the House of Lords she has sat on a range of committees addressing issues from racial equality, social affairs, and the education of children from minority groups. The Baroness was awarded The Pravasi Bharatiya Samman (Overseas Indian Award) in 2009 by the President of India.
Philip D Harvey
Philip Harvey is the president of DKT International which he founded in 1989. He was co-founder (with Dr Black) of Population Services International. Mr Harvey has been championing the benefits of social marketing for over three decades. Earlier he served as deputy director of CARE's program in India.
Virgilio Pernito
Virgilio Pernito heads our partner entity, Population Services Pilipinas Incorporated, in the Philippines. His venture in the field of sexual and reproductive health comes after managing a nutritional marketing project for Helen Keller International. Prior to social development, Virgilio led the turnaround of a profit centre with the Philippine National Bank as well as working on global advertising accounts with McCann Erickson Worldwide. He is now based in Manila and previously lived in the USA where he gained his MBA at the University of Michigan.
Dr Kristin Anne Rutter, MB, MChir, MA (Cantab), MBA
Dr Rutter practised as a doctor in Iceland before joining McKinsey and Company in 2001 where she now works as Senior Engagement Manager focusing on healthcare and strategy. Dr Rutter gained her MBA from Harvard Business School and trained as a medical doctor at the University of Cambridge School of Clinical Medicine.
